which makes the Harris trade absolutely horrible.

 

For me, Harris was in the same boat as Fournier. They are good players. They are not a foundation piece.

 

We hoped Harris would be a foundation piece. He wasn't. i will be shocked if he is ever part of a big three. Do I wish we had landed an Ibaka when we traded Harris? Sure i do, but if we could have, we would have. As it is, a portion of his salary helped us get Ibaka.

 

Vic was a great personality. He may actually be part of a big three in OKC that competes for championships because he compliments the other two so well. That said, we all have discussed the limitations of having Payton and Vic in the same back court. Henny was burned by Harris' RFA, is facing the same thing with Fournier and made a deal to move Vic before RFA to get us the perfect complimentary player for Vuc. Ibaka has been part of a big three so it isn't hard to see him in that role moving forward.

 

You can add Nicholson and Harkless to the list of talented young players that the Magic hoped would be a foundation piece that didn't turn out as hoped.

 

So as it stands now, the potential foundation pieces still to evaluate are Payton, Hezonja and Gordon. Ibaka and Vuc appear to be legit foundation pieces. Assuming Hezonja and Gordon don't regress, that starting line-up should be able to compete for a playoff berth. If Hezonja and Gordon become legit two-way players this rebuild works and we are competing for top 4 spot in the playoffs. Moreover, with the cap space available next year we could add a star to take us to championship level.

 

And it all started with moving on from Harris. I can't find fault with that move.
